Description
While dumping a table with a quoted identifier `numeric`, doctrine failed because the constructed query had an invalid alias the field: c__`numeric`.
Output:
SQLSTATE[42000]: Syntax error or access violation: 1064 You have an error in your SQL syntax; check the manual that corresponds to your MySQL server version for the right syntax to use near '`numeric`, c.alpha3 AS c_alpha3, c.alpha2 AS calpha2 FROM country_codes c' at line 1. Failing Query: "SELECT c.country AS ccountry, c.`numeric` AS c`numeric`, c.alpha3 AS calpha3, c.alpha2 AS c_alpha2 FROM country_codes c"
I know that using quoted identifiers is discouraged but I think this could be easily solvable.
